Understanding Game Variety and Odds
A key component of succeeding in any casino environment, whether physical or digital, is a comprehensive grasp of the games offered and the associated odds. Different games carry different levels of risk and potential reward. For instance, games like blackjack, when played with optimal strategy, can offer relatively low house edges, meaning players have a better chance of winning over the long term. Conversely, slot machines often have higher house edges, relying more on luck than skill. Understanding these probabilities is the first step towards making informed decisions and minimizing potential losses. Players should thoroughly research the rules and strategies for each game before investing their money. Many online resources offer detailed guides and tutorials on various casino games, providing valuable insights for both beginners and experienced players. This research extends to understanding payout percentages (RTP – Return to Player) which offer a clue to how frequently a game is likely to pay out.
The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
The fairness of online casino games relies heavily on the integrity of Random Number Generators (RNGs). These sophisticated algorithms ensure that each game's outcome is truly random and unbiased. Reputable online casinos employ RNGs that are independently tested and certified by third-party auditing firms. This certification assures players that the games are fair and that the casino isn’t manipulating the results. It's important to only play at casinos that prominently display their RNG certification, as this demonstrates a commitment to transparency and player protection. Investigating these certifications provides an extra layer of security and trust when participating in online gaming.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ge | Skill Level Required |
|---|---|---|
| Blackjack (Optimal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% | High |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Low |
| Baccarat | 1.06% (Banker Bet) | Low |
| Slot Machines | 2% – 15% | Very Low |
The table above provides a general overview of typical house edges for common casino games. Remember that these are averages, and the actual house edge can vary depending on the specific game rules and the casino offering it. Recognizing these differences will empower players to make smarter choices aligned with their risk tolerance and playing style.
Effective Bankroll Management Strategies
One of the most crucial aspects of responsible gaming is managing your bankroll effectively. A bankroll is the amount of money you’ve allocated specifically for gambling, and it should be treated as disposable income. Never gamble with money that you need for essential expenses like rent, food, or bills. Before starting to play, establish a strict budget and stick to it, regardless of whether you’re winning or losing. Consider breaking down your bankroll into smaller units, and only wager a small percentage of your total bankroll on each individual bet. This approach helps to mitigate risk and extend your playing time. Avoiding the temptation to chase losses is paramount; attempting to recoup losses by increasing your bets often leads to even greater financial setbacks.
Setting Limits and Recognizing Warning Signs
Beyond budgeting, setting clear limits is essential for responsible gaming. Casinos often provide tools to help players set deposit limits, loss limits, and time limits. Utilize these features to control your spending and prevent yourself from gambling more than you can afford. It’s vital to also be aware of warning signs that may indicate a developing gambling problem. These signs include spending more time and money gambling than intended, lying to others about your gambling habits, and experiencing feelings of guilt or remorse after gambling. If you recognize any of these signs, seek help from a trusted friend, family member, or a professional gambling addiction support organization. Recognizing and addressing these issues early can prevent significant personal and financial harm.
- Define a clear gambling budget before you begin.
- Only gamble with disposable income, never essential funds.
- Set deposit, loss, and time limits at the casino.
- Avoid chasing losses by increasing your bets.
- Recognize the warning signs of a gambling problem and seek help if needed.
Implementing these strategies and being mindful of your gambling habits can transform your experience from potentially harmful to a controlled form of entertainment. A proactive approach to bankroll management and self-awareness is the key to enjoying online casinos responsibly.
Leveraging Bonuses and Promotions
Online casinos frequently offer a variety of b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onuses can provide an extra boost to your bankroll, it’s crucial to understand the terms and conditions associated with them. Many bonuses come with wagering requirements, which specify the amount you need to wager before you can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. Be sure to carefully read the fine print to avoid any surprises and to ensure that the bonus is truly beneficial. Understanding the play-through requirements and any game restrictions is vital. Not all games contribute equally towards fulfilling wagering requirements; for example, slot machines often contribute 100%, while table games may only contribute a smaller percentage.
Understanding Wagering Requirements and Game Restrictions
Wagering requirements represent the number of times you must bet the bonus amount (or the deposit plus bonus amount) before you can withdraw any winnings. A wagering requirement of 30x means you need to wager 30 times the bonus amount. It’s essential to calculate whether the wagering requirements are reasonable and attainable before accepting a bonus. Game restrictions specify which games you are allowed to play with the bonus funds. Some bonuses may only be valid for slot machines, while others may exclude certain popular games. Taking the time to analyze these conditions allows players to maximize the value of bonuses and avoid frustration down the line. Failure to comply with the terms and conditions can result in the forfeiture of bonus winnings.
- Read the terms and conditions of any bonus offer carefully.
- Understand the wagering requirements and calculate their impact.
- Be aware of game restrictions and which games contribute towards wagering.
- Consider the time limit for fulfilling the wagering requirements.
- Verify the maximum withdrawal limit associated with the bonus.
Effectively utilizing bonuses and promotions can enhance your gaming experience and potentially increase your chances of winning, but always approach them with a critical eye and a clear understanding of the requirements involved.
The Importance of Choosing a Reputable Platform
Selecting a reputable and licensed online casino is paramount for ensuring a safe and fair gaming experience. A licensed casino is subject to regulation and oversight by a respected gaming authority, ensuring that it adheres to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gaming. Research the casino’s licensing information, typically displayed on their website. Look for licenses from well-known regulatory bodies, such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, or the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ority. Additionally, check for independent reviews and ratings from reputable sources to gauge the casino’s reputation among players. Customer support responsiveness and availability are also important indicators of a trustworthy platform. A reliable casino should offer multiple channels of support, such as live chat, email, and phone, and provide prompt and helpful assistance when needed.
